About this course

Marketing management is the discipline concerned with understanding customers, developing products and services that meet their needs, and communicating the value of those offerings in ways that reach and engage the right people. As the University of Westminster puts it, marketing lies at the heart of every successful business: marketing managers influence product development, advise on pricing and distribution, and identify the most effective ways to make sure target markets know what is on offer, in increasingly creative and dynamic ways. The discipline combines analytical thinking with creative skill, quantitative data with psychological insight. Westminster's three-year full-time Marketing Management degree carries a typical entry tariff of 104 points and includes a sandwich year, a year abroad option, and work placement opportunities. This means you can gain substantial professional marketing experience before you graduate, and potentially study in a different country, broadening your understanding of how marketing operates in different cultural and economic contexts. You will study consumer behaviour, brand management, digital marketing, market research, communications strategy, and the financial and operational dimensions of marketing management, developing both the strategic thinking and the practical skills that marketing roles require. Graduates pursue careers in marketing management, brand management, digital marketing, advertising, public relations, market research, product management, and commercial roles across virtually every sector. Consumer goods, retail, financial services, technology, media, charities, and public sector organisations all employ marketing managers. Many graduates pursue professional qualifications through the Chartered Institute of Marketing, and postgraduate study in marketing, data analytics, or business is an option for those wanting to specialise further.
